As winter approaches, dehumidifiers become essential for homes plagued by mold and harmful bacteria. Even in spotless homes, moisture can lead to these issues. A reliable dehumidifier effectively prevents these conditions.

Dehumidifiers operate by extracting excess moisture from indoor air, collecting it in a removable tank or directing it outside via a hose.

Mold flourishes in damp spaces, but maintaining humidity below 60% significantly reduces its growth. Plus, they help your laundry dry quicker by absorbing moisture!

Do dehumidifiers eliminate all moisture in a space?

Dehumidifiers maintain optimal humidity levels, which is not the same as complete dryness. Recommended humidity should be around 45-60%, with many units adjusting automatically to stay in this range.

Excessively dry air can worsen issues like allergies and snoring, and facilitate germ survival. This is why some households also use humidifiers to balance moisture during dry seasons.

Can dehumidifiers remove mold?

While high humidity is a primary cause of mold, dehumidifiers cannot eliminate existing mold. It's advisable to remove visible mold from areas like basements and bathrooms before using a dehumidifier.

However, once in operation, a dehumidifier can significantly reduce future mold growth. That's a win!

What distinguishes a dehumidifier from an air conditioner?

If you're exploring options, you may have seen portable air conditioners. These units can also lower humidity while cooling your home. Many effective portable air conditioners serve dual purposes as dehumidifiers and fans, but they tend to be pricier and bulkier.

For ease of use and portability, we recommend sticking with a dehumidifier.
